Regulatory Environment and Compliance
The regulatory landscape significantly impacts the online poker market in Hungary. The Szerencsejáték Zrt. (Hungarian National Lottery) plays a key role in licensing and regulating online gambling activities. Analysts must stay informed about changes in legislation, licensing requirements, and tax regulations. Compliance with responsible gambling guidelines is also essential. This includes measures such as age verification, deposit limits, self-exclusion programs, and the provision of information about problem gambling. The enforcement of these regulations, including the penalties for non-compliance, directly affects the operational costs and the overall attractiveness of the market for operators. Furthermore, the regulatory environment influences the level of competition. Strict regulations may limit the number of licensed operators, while a more liberal approach can attract more entrants. Staying abreast of these developments is critical for assessing the long-term sustainability and profitability of online poker operations in Hungary.
Technological Advancements and Platform Features
Technological advancements constantly reshape the online poker landscape. The quality of the gaming platform, including the user interface, game graphics, and software stability, is a key factor in player satisfaction. The integration of mobile gaming capabilities, allowing players to access games on smartphones and tablets, is now essential. Live dealer poker, where players interact with real dealers via video streaming, is also gaining popularity. Other important features include the availability of different game formats, such as fast-fold poker and progressive jackpot games. The use of data analytics to personalize the player experience and detect fraudulent activities is also becoming increasingly sophisticated. The security of the platform, including the protection of player data and financial transactions, is of paramount importance. Regular audits and certifications from independent testing agencies help to ensure the integrity and fairness of the games. The ability of a platform to adapt to new technologies and player preferences is a key indicator of its long-term success.
